For small and simple parts, I use the
Anilam, on the right.

The Anilam has many great built-in
programs which allows me to CNC mill
directly without going through Master Cam.

Sometimes, it's QUICK !!!


For complex or tight tolerance parts, I use
the HAAS.

Generally, it takes more time, but

MasterCam + Haas = Consider It's done
